117.info
人生若只如初见

redis bigmap的最佳实践有哪些

在使用Redis BigMap时,以下是一些最佳实践:

  1. 内存优化:BigMap使用Redis作为存储引擎,因此要确保Redis服务器的内存足够大以容纳数据。可以通过监控内存使用情况,并定期清理不再需要的数据来优化内存使用。

  2. 数据分片:对于大规模数据,可以将数据分片存储在多个BigMap实例中,以提高性能和减少单个实例的负载。

  3. 数据压缩:对于大型数据,可以考虑使用数据压缩算法来减小存储空间占用,并提高数据传输效率。

  4. 数据备份:定期对BigMap中的数据进行备份,以防数据丢失或意外删除。

  5. 数据同步:使用Redis的复制功能或者第三方工具来实现数据同步,确保数据在多个实例之间的一致性。

  6. 错误处理:在操作BigMap时要处理可能出现的错误情况,例如网络中断、数据丢失等,以保证系统的稳定性和可靠性。

  7. 安全性:对BigMap进行安全配置,包括访问权限控制、数据加密等,确保数据不被恶意访问或篡改。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fedddAzsIAw9RAFA.html

推荐文章

  • redis bigmap与传统数据结构比较

    Redis Bigmap 是 Redis 的一种数据结构,用于存储键值对数据。与传统数据结构相比,Redis Bigmap 具有以下优势: 内存存储:Redis Bigmap 存储在内存中,读写速度...

  • redis bigmap如何有效管理内存

    Redis BigMap 是一个 Redis 模块,用于存储大规模的数据集,可以有效管理内存的方法如下: 使用 Redis BigMap 的过期功能:可以设置键值对的过期时间,让 Redis ...

  • redis bigmap适合哪些场景使用

    Redis BigMap 适合用于需要高性能、高并发、快速访问大量数据的场景,特别是在需要频繁读写大规模数据集的情况下。以下是一些适合使用 Redis BigMap 的场景: 缓...

  • redis bigmap的扩展性能评估

    要对Redis BigMap的扩展性能进行评估,可以考虑以下几个方面: 数据规模:测试BigMap在不同数据规模下的性能表现,包括存储大量数据和处理大量并发请求时的性能表...

  • redis bigmap的性能表现如何

    Redis Bigmap 是一个用于存储大规模数据集的数据结构,它能够在 Redis 中有效地存储和查询大量的键值对。因为 Bigmap 是基于 Redis 的 Sorted Set 数据结构实现的...

  • redis bigmap可以解决什么问题

    Redis BigMap可以解决以下问题: 存储大量数据:BigMap可以存储非常大的数据集,比如数百万或数十亿个键值对。
    高性能访问:BigMap可以实现高性能的读写操作...

  • java facade模式在大型项目中的应用

    在大型项目中,Facade模式可以用来简化复杂系统的接口和交互操作,将系统的各个部分进行抽象和封装,从而提供一个统一的接口供外部系统调用。这样可以降低系统的...

  • java facade模式的测试策略有哪些

    单元测试:针对Facade模式中的每个子系统模块编写单元测试,验证其功能是否正确。 集成测试:测试Facade模式整体功能,验证Facade类是否能够正确调用各个子系统模...